Description
The 2012 Langhe Giàrborina is a reincarnation of the wine previously known as Langhe Arborina. Because a Langhe appellation wine cannot be named by its vineyard name (like Barolo can), Elio Altare was told to remove the name Arborina. In a clever twist, he renamed it ""giàrborina"" that is loosely translated as ""formally Arborina."" This is a pure expression of Nebbiolo that is graceful and elegant with bright berries and pressed flowers. It is streamlined and tight in the mouth with lingering flavors of licorice, spice and toasted nut. - Wine Advocate
